Illustration of the Voltmeter

A third party voltage instrument is part of The Analog Thing. It is located in the lower left on the upper board and a central part of the board. Unfortunately it is not analog but digital, in order to be cheap (price around 5 Euro). The instrument is a PM438 and normally shows the voltage on the output channel U.

The instrument can show bipolar voltages, i.e. it can show values in the whole logic level domain of ±1.
